What was the military operation in the Persian Gulf War called
Operation Desert Storm: 25 Years Since the First Gulf War. On January 16, 1991, President George H. W. Bush announced the start of what would be called Operation Desert Storm—a military operation to expel occupying Iraqi forces from Kuwait, which Iraq had invaded and annexed months earlier.
